Can You Pack Juul In Checked Bags?

Regarding traveling with vaping devices, some rules and regulations apply depending on the airline and country you’re flying from. While some airlines allow other vaping devices in checked bags, carrying a Juul in your luggage may not be as straightforward.

The Transportation Security Administration (TSA) allows passengers to bring e-cigarettes and vaping devices on planes but prohibits them from being packed in checked bags. If you want to take your vape juice or Juul pods on a flight, they must be packed in your hand luggage.

It’s important to note that while the TSA has set these guidelines for carrying Juul pods on a plane, individual airlines may have their own rules regarding these items. Therefore, checking with the airline before packing any vaping device or related accessories in your luggage is always best.

Does The 3-1-1 Rule Apply To Juul Pods?

The 3-1-1 rule applies to liquids and gels in carry-on bags on airplanes. This means you can bring a quart-sized bag of liquids or gels that are 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) or less per item. However, the question arises regarding Juul pods: do they fall under this category? The answer is yes.

According to the Transportation Security Administration (TSA), e-cigarettes and vapes, including Juul devices and pods, are allowed in carry-on bags but not checked bags because of the fire risk. As for how many Juul pods you can bring, there is no specific limit stated by TSA or airlines. However, it’s essential to keep them within the limits of the 3-1-1 rule, as each pod contains about 0.7mL of liquid.
